Service portal Defer Loading

sudharsana r1
Kilo Guru

The ServiceNow Zurich release introduces a powerful enhancement for optimizing Service Portal load times.
With the new configuration options available in the Page Designer, you can now control when specific widgets load on a page. This allows for smarter resource management and faster page rendering.

To improve your Service Portal page performance, follow these steps to configure widget loading behavior effectively.

  • Open the page in page designer
  • Click on the icon displayed in image below and configure defer loading.

 

Defer Loading.png

 
3 REPLIES 3

GarethH1
Tera Contributor

How can this be disabled in its entirety? The instance options do not help when unchecking, as the portal homepage loads, it shows widget for a split second, and then does not load the widget, rendering homepages blank.

@GarethH1 - 

  In ServiceNow, there’s no supported way to disable deferred widget loading globally. The Zurich change is widget-level, so instance options won’t override it.

To fix blank homepages, open each affected page in Page Designer, select the widgets, turn off “Defer loading”, save, and clear the portal cache. The Instance settings alone won’t undo widget-level defer settings from memory. Hope this helps!

Matthew_13
Kilo Sage

@sudharsana r1  - This is a simple but impactful improvement in the ServiceNow Zurich release. Being able to defer widget loading in Page Designer gives teams an easy, practical way to speed up Service Portal pages without redesigning them. Small configuration change, big performance win.